... school, uni, or life commitments. Managers who support your growth and ...
17 days ago
... school, uni, or life commitments. Managers who support your growth and ...
19 days ago
... school, uni, or life commitments. Managers who support your growth and ...
20 days ago
... school, uni, or life commitments. Managers who support your growth and ...
20 days ago
... school, uni, or life commitments. Managers who support your growth and ...
21 days ago